What is 4 7/8 as an improper fraction

Respuesta :

kjshaw84 kjshaw84
  • 23-08-2017
39/8. Multiply the denominator (bottom number) and the whole number; then add the numerator (top number) to the product. The denominator will remain the same as in the mixed fraction.
